Resources of Industrial Waste Water



Industrial wastewater originates from a selection of resources, each contributing to the intricacy of therapy processes. Mostly, these resources include producing centers, refineries, and handling plants, which generate effluents as a byproduct of their procedures. Industries such as textiles, drugs, food and beverage, and petrochemicals create substantial quantities of wastewater, often filled with contaminants consisting of hefty steels, natural substances, and nutrients.


In enhancement to production, agricultural activities add to industrial wastewater with overflow and effluent from animals procedures and plant processing. The meat and dairy industries, in specific, are understood for releasing high degrees of biochemical oxygen need (FIGURE) and virus.


Furthermore, mining and mineral handling tasks generate wastewater containing suspended solids and dangerous chemicals. Power generation plants, particularly those utilizing fossil fuels, also add wastewater with cooling down systems and chemical cleansing processes.


Each of these sources presents unique challenges relating to the structure and quantity of wastewater created, necessitating tailored therapy options to alleviate their ecological influence. Understanding the diverse origins of industrial wastewater is vital for establishing efficient administration strategies focused on safeguarding water resources and promoting lasting commercial practices.


Therapy Procedures and Technologies



Reliable therapy processes and modern technologies are vital for handling industrial wastewater and alleviating its ecological influence. Different methods are used to eliminate pollutants, adjust to different wastewater features, and conform with regulatory criteria.


Physical treatment processes, such as sedimentation and purification, promote the elimination of suspended solids. These methods are commonly made use of as initial steps to reduce the lots on subsequent therapy phases. Chemical therapy, including flocculation, neutralization, and coagulation, addresses dissolved contaminants by modifying their chemical residential properties, making them much easier to separate from water.


Biological therapy technologies, such as triggered sludge systems and biofilters, make use this link of microorganisms to degrade organic matter and nutrients. These techniques are specifically effective for eco-friendly waste streams, advertising the natural decay procedure. Advanced therapy technologies, such as membrane filtering and advanced oxidation procedures, deal enhanced removal effectiveness for tough toxins, consisting of hefty steels and persistent organic compounds.


Each of these treatment procedures can be configured in various combinations to produce customized remedies that fulfill particular commercial requirements. The choice of innovation relies on factors such as the sort of wastewater, preferred treatment end results, and economic considerations, guaranteeing that markets can operate sustainably while lessening their eco-friendly footprint.

Regulative Structure and Compliance



A detailed regulatory framework controls the treatment of industrial wastewater, ensuring that markets follow stringent conformity standards. Different nationwide and local guidelines, such as the Tidy Water Act in the United States, established forth limits on the discharge of contaminants right into water bodies. These laws are developed to secure aquatic ecological communities and public wellness by mandating that sectors execute proper therapy modern technologies.


Conformity with these policies commonly entails obtaining permits, carrying out routine surveillance, and reporting discharge levels to regulative authorities. Failure to conform can lead to considerable fines, consisting of penalties and functional constraints, thus incentivizing industries to adopt finest practices in wastewater administration.


Along with governmental policies, lots of markets likewise abide by volunteer standards and certifications, such as ISO 14001, which promote lasting ecological monitoring methods. Stakeholders are progressively advocating for improved transparency and accountability in wastewater management, pressing for stricter enforcement and more strenuous reporting demands.


Ultimately, a durable governing framework not only offers to minimize ecological dangers but additionally promotes a society of sustainability within the commercial industry, encouraging continual enhancement in my link wastewater treatment procedures.
